MUSC 127 - Music Production 1



3.0 Credits
Apply concepts learned in MUSC 126 in the music production studio. Students learn audio recording, editing, and mixing,as well as MIDI, synthesis, and sampling. Students are invited to use the Edmonds CollegeMusic Studios for the duration of this course.
Prerequisite MUSC 126 with a minimum grade of 2.0 or instructor permission. Corequisite: MUSC 200.
Corequisite MUSC 200.

Course-level Learning Objectives (CLOs)
Upon successful completion of this course, students will be able to:

  1. Set up and run small recording sessions.
  2. Apply common mixing and mastering techniques to multi-track recordings.
  3. Create original synthesizer and sampler software instruments.
  4. Integrate music and sound design into video footage.
  5. Complete a full-length original audio composition/production.
  6. Identify common studio production techniques by ear.
